Green's 16 Lead Tulsa Past San Jose State 81-51

Tulsa’s 18-0 second-half run secured a dominant 30-point victory with David Green scoring 16 points, supported by Ade Popoola and Miles Barnstable.

  • On Tuesday in Palm Desert, the Tulsa Golden Hurricane defeated the San Jose State Spartans as David Green scored 16 points and had five rebounds.
  • Tulsa seized momentum by taking the lead with 16:20 remaining in the first half and led 43-33 at halftime, The Associated Press reported.
  • An 18-0 run in the second half fueled Tulsa's surge, with Miles Barnstable supplying a team-high seven points to bolster the offense.
  • Tulsa's balanced scoring featured Green's contributions and support from other scorers, while San Jose State was led by Colby Garland, who posted 13 points.
